In 2025, The Irving Law Firm welcomed Madison Howell to the practice. Her work centers on criminal defense and civil litigation, where she assists in representing retained clients, providing court-appointed indigent defense, and addressing civil disputes in both Circuit Court and General District Court.
Madison is originally from Knoxville, Tennessee. She earned her Bachelor of Arts in Political Science from Sewanee: The University of the South in 2021, along with minors in Biology, Chemistry, and Classical Languages. During her undergraduate years, she participated in several honor societies, volunteered at a local free health clinic, and contributed her time to The Ronald McDonald House.
She went on to graduate from The Washington and Lee School of Law in 2024. While there, Madison served as an editor for the German Law Journal, led the Health Law Association as President, and sat on the board of the Women’s Law Students Organization. She also worked in the school’s Low-Income Taxpayer Clinic, assisting individuals who needed help disputing IRS claims.
Throughout law school, Madison developed experience across various legal areas. Her interest in civil litigation grew through a 2023 externship with the Office of the Solicitor at the United States Department of Labor. Before joining The Irving Law Firm, she continued to focus on civil litigation work.
In her free time, Madison enjoys reading, listening to podcasts, and traveling with her husband.
